A compounding control method to prepare a compounded mixture for use with at least one pharmaceutical compounding device having an associated plurality of source solutions and a mixture receptacle. The method comprises determining whether the plurality of source solutions conform to a predetermined configuration providing an alert to an operator and preventing compounding if the source solutions are not as expected determining respective expiration dates of the source solutions warning/preventing use of any of the source solutions if any have the source solutions have expired accepting mixture inputs for the source solutions and urging at least a portion of at least one of the source solutions into the mixture receptacle based on the mixture inputs to form the compounded mixture.